Skip to content

tests: Enable invalid block blockchain tests#1088

Merged
pdobacz merged 3 commits intomasterfrom
enable-inv-bloack
Dec 18, 2024
Merged

tests: Enable invalid block blockchain tests#1088
pdobacz merged 3 commits intomasterfrom
enable-inv-bloack

Conversation

@pdobacz
Copy link
Copy Markdown
Member

@pdobacz pdobacz commented Dec 17, 2024

I took the liberty to coarsely disable 4844 (and 4788) blockchain tests across the board, as they will be re-enabled in #1077, which needs to be rebased on top of these changes (invalid block blockchain tests handling in that branch is currently not complete!).

Before merging I'll squash the 1st and last commits together, they aim at the same thing.

Note, that a next step would be to respect the expectException field from the test and only accept specific reasons for block invalidity. For now I only handle valid-invalid.

@pdobacz pdobacz requested review from chfast and gumb0 December 17, 2024 16:13
@pdobacz pdobacz self-assigned this Dec 17, 2024
Comment thread circle.yml
Comment thread test/blockchaintest/blockchaintest_loader.cpp
Comment thread test/blockchaintest/blockchaintest_loader.cpp Outdated
@pdobacz pdobacz merged commit c8eb992 into master Dec 18, 2024
@pdobacz pdobacz deleted the enable-inv-bloack branch December 18, 2024 19:24
hanzo-dev pushed a commit to luxcpp/cevm that referenced this pull request Apr 26, 2026
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

3 participants